So I fiddled with it some more and now it speaks as it should. I needed to set environment language to english for navit. I created navit_en in /usr/bin:
Code:
#!/bin/sh export LC_ALL="en_GB.utf8" navit export LC_ALL="cs_CZ.UTF-8"
And made it executable.
And then I
made a shortcut
. Editing navit .desktop file for some reason did not work.
I also made adjustments to my OSD layout and not I think it works well. I now use 96x96 icons, as they are large so one can better use them while driving. I added clock and I made speed bigger and without units (as I know it is in km/h, I am interested in the number. See attached screenshot.
